About this Property
At River Crossing Lodge, guests can enjoy the outdoor pool, terrace, and garden. The hotel also offers complimentary Wi-Fi, gift shops, and a lobby fireplace. Indulge in a meal at the on-site restaurant and unwind at the bar/lounge or poolside bar. Start your day with a free buffet breakfast and take advantage of the business center, luggage storage, and laundry facilities. For events, there are conference space and a meeting room available. With a roundtrip airport shuttle and free parking, convenience is key. - Caroline (6/5): Mixed feelings - First of all if you are travelling to this hotel from the airport at night, it is easy to miss. It is not signposted with the brown hotel signs. Look for the second brown wine country sign and it is just near there with an advert type sign.
Our room was fine, it was just little things like a cracked basin and the towel rail that constantly fell off the holder.
The food was good but breakfast the first day had a good selection, on day too there was no bread much less choice and the fruit salad I had included a dead fly.
The swimming pool unfortunately did not look clean.
The hotel has wonderful views, but we felt the hotel needed a bit more love and care, which is ashame as the staff were lovely.
